1. What is Headless WordPress and Why Should You Consider It?

Headless WordPress refers to the decoupling of the frontend and backend of a WordPress website. While WordPress has traditionally been a monolithic CMS, combining the content management and frontend display in one platform, a headless setup separates the backend (content storage) from the frontend (presentation layer). Content is stored in WordPress and delivered to the frontend through an API, usually via REST or GraphQL.

This decoupling provides greater flexibility, allowing businesses to deliver content across multiple channels and devices, including websites, mobile apps, IoT devices, and more. By using a headless WordPress setup, enterprises can create more dynamic and personalized experiences for their users, leading to improved engagement and retention.

2. Next.js: The Perfect Frontend Framework for Headless WordPress

Next.js is a React-based framework that offers static site generation (SSG), server-side rendering (SSR), and client-side rendering (CSR). It is designed to improve performance, optimize SEO, and deliver seamless user experiences. When paired with WordPress as a headless CMS, Next.js offers numerous advantages for enterprises looking to scale their websites efficiently.

Next.js allows for pre-rendering pages during build time (SSG), meaning content is ready to be delivered instantly to the user without requiring server-side processing. This leads to faster load times and a more responsive website. Furthermore, Next.js enables SSR for dynamic pages, ensuring that fresh, up-to-date content is delivered to users, enhancing SEO and providing a real-time experience.

3. Key Benefits of Using Headless WordPress with Next.js

By integrating Headless WordPress with Next.js, enterprises can enjoy a range of benefits that enhance their website’s performance, scalability, and user experience:

Improved Website Performance

One of the most significant advantages of using Next.js with Headless WordPress is improved website performance. Next.js’s static site generation (SSG) pre-renders content at build time, reducing the need for real-time server-side rendering. This results in faster load times, which are critical for providing a seamless user experience. Faster websites lead to better engagement, higher conversion rates, and improved SEO.

Scalability for Growing Enterprises

As businesses grow, the need for scalable solutions becomes more pressing. With a headless setup, the backend (WordPress) and frontend (Next.js) are independent of each other, allowing for scalable growth on both ends. WordPress handles content management, while Next.js can scale the frontend as needed, handling high volumes of traffic without compromising performance. This flexibility ensures that enterprises can easily adapt to increasing demands.

Enhanced User Experience (UX)

The combination of Next.js and Headless WordPress offers a significantly enhanced user experience. Next.js provides fast page transitions, real-time data fetching, and a smooth user interface. This results in an engaging, interactive experience for visitors, which is critical for keeping users on the site and improving retention rates. Additionally, the ability to implement personalized experiences based on user behavior becomes easier when using a headless CMS approach.

SEO Optimization

SEO is crucial for enterprise websites aiming to rank well on search engines. Next.js’s built-in server-side rendering (SSR) and static site generation (SSG) provide excellent SEO advantages. SSR ensures that search engine crawlers can access fully-rendered HTML pages, leading to better indexation and ranking. Additionally, Next.js optimizes pages for fast loading, which is a key factor in SEO rankings.

Multi-Channel Content Delivery

With a headless WordPress setup, content is delivered via APIs, making it easier to distribute content across various channels. Whether it’s a website, mobile app, or even a smart device, you can deliver the same content seamlessly. This multi-channel distribution ensures that enterprises can reach a broader audience while maintaining consistency in messaging and branding.

4. How to Implement a Headless WordPress and Next.js Setup

Implementing a headless WordPress setup with Next.js requires some technical know-how, but the process can be broken down into manageable steps:

Step 1: Install and Set Up WordPress

Start by setting up WordPress on your server. Install the necessary plugins, such as the WPGraphQL plugin, which allows for querying data using GraphQL, or the REST API plugin for RESTful data delivery. These plugins will enable WordPress to communicate with the frontend (Next.js) via API requests.

Step 2: Build Your Frontend with Next.js

Next, set up a Next.js project. You can create a Next.js app from scratch using the Next.js CLI or use a template designed for WordPress integration. Once the Next.js project is ready, you’ll need to configure it to fetch data from your WordPress backend using either GraphQL or REST APIs. You’ll also need to implement features like static site generation and server-side rendering to take full advantage of Next.js’s performance benefits.

Step 3: Fetch and Display Content

Using GraphQL or REST APIs, fetch content from your WordPress installation. This could include blog posts, pages, products, or any custom post types. Then, use Next.js to display this content dynamically on your frontend. With Next.js, you can ensure that your pages are pre-rendered for fast delivery and real-time updates where necessary.

Step 4: Optimize for Performance

Optimize your Next.js app for performance by enabling caching, minifying code, and serving static assets from a CDN. Use tools like Lighthouse to test your site’s performance and ensure it meets modern web standards. Also, make sure to configure your hosting environment for scalability to handle increasing traffic.
